Output 859d3dc32eb6eae744e609e5000790b20bb38b64b01767319e36a9524c99a051:21

value
709818
script pubkey
OP_0 OP_PUSHBYTES_20 6024975841fc215b0b86b3c5b7a6a634d80a37fc
address
bc1qvqjfwkzplss4kzuxk0zm0f4xxnvq5dlulhuj3l
transaction
859d3dc32eb6eae744e609e5000790b20bb38b64b01767319e36a9524c99a051
confirmations
145649
spent
true